Designing data-intensive applications

Designing data-intensive applications in C++ involves considering various aspects, including data storage, data processing, and efficient utilization of system resources. This section will list some key considerations and best practices for designing data-intensive applications in C++.

To begin with, some best practices for data modeling and storage are listed as follows:

  • Identify the nature and structure of the data: Analyze the data requirements and determine the appropriate data model, such as relational, NoSQL, or a combination of both, based on the application’s needs.
  • Choose efficient data storage solutions: Select appropriate data storage technologies, such as databases (MySQL, PostgreSQL, and MongoDB) or distributed filesystems (Hadoop HDFS and Apache Cassandra), based on factors such as scalability, performance, and data integrity requirements.
